If the job was supposed to be 3 weeks, you are on week 4, I'd think if you have done a good, quick efficient job on the work you have been given, I'd say you probably have a decent shot at sticking around.

Have you made it known that you don't want to leave? If they like you and the work you've done that still may not be enough for them to try to find a position for you unless they are aware of the fact that you want to stay... some people like the constant newness of being a temporary worker, and companies have been burned by hiring a good temp who quickly tires and becomes a bad permanent employee. Make sure they know you want to stay.

Even if they don't end up making you a permanent employee if they know you want to stick around they may contact you for the next temp job position or even next time a permanent spot opens up.
